Pros

KPMG allows you to learn alot about auditing, advisory, and contracting. Training is mandatory and emphasized. The company also recognizes relevant certifications and rewards employees with bonuses and reimbursement. You can travel if traveling is what you want. Pay is also pretty decent.

Cons

LONG hours. 10 hour days are normal. 12 hour days are common with no overtime pay, especially during the busy season. Instead of overtime pay, bonuses are based on "utilization" at the end of the year.
